Ixtlahuaca de Rayón is a significant local hub located within the State of Mexico. This small city maintains a strong sense of tradition, with its daily life centered around the main plaza and local markets. It serves as an excellent base for those wishing to experience the authentic, non-commercialized side of central Mexico. The town is characterized by its quiet streets, friendly community, and proximity to the region's agricultural heartland. While it offers fewer tourist amenities than nearby Toluca, its charm lies in its genuine atmosphere and historical roots. Visitors can explore the central plaza, which serves as the heart of the community, and enjoy the authentic flavors of regional cuisine.

Before you go: Ixtlahuaca de Rayón essentials

  • Limited selection of tourist-oriented hotels and restaurants.

  • Public transportation to nearby rural areas is frequent but can be crowded.

  • The town is best explored on foot to appreciate its quiet atmosphere.

Market Days

Visit on traditional market days to see the town at its most vibrant and sample local street food.

Language

Learning basic Spanish phrases will greatly enhance your experience as English is not common.
